Example Calculation
Let’s understand how the Money Hour Calculator works with a real-life example.
Scenario:
- Hourly Rate: $15
- Hours Worked Per Day: 8
- Working Days Per Month: 22
- Overtime Multiplier: 1.5
Step-by-Step Breakdown:
Daily Income:
$15 × 8 = $120 per day
Monthly Income:
$120 × 22 = $2,640 per month
Yearly Income:
$2,640 × 12 = $31,680 per year
Overtime Monthly Income (1 hour/day at 1.5x):
$15 × 1.5 × 22 = $495 per month

Why Understanding Hourly Income Matters
Many people only focus on monthly salary, but hourly breakdown gives deeper insights:
- Helps identify underpaid jobs
- Shows real value of your time
- Improves negotiation power during salary discussions
- Encourages smarter time management
For example, if you earn $20/hour but work unpaid overtime, your real effective hourly rate decreases. Tools like this help reveal such insights clearly.
